    GROUND FLOOR FLAT 11, DEVONSHIRE ROAD, PALMERS GREEN, LONDON, N13 4QU

    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on Devonshire Road last sold in November 2019 for £449,995. Based on price growth in the N13 district since then, its estimated current value is £539,315 — placing it in the 82nd percentile nationally and the 47th percentile within N13. The property covers 63 m² (678 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£8,561 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of C.
